Mr. Md. Ariful Islam



Designation: Assistant Professor

Email: ariful.islam.eee@aust.edu

Office Extension: 613

Room No: 422



Research Interests

  • Load Power curve in distribution side.
  • Battery power management of PEV.

Educational Background

  • Masters in Engineering (MEngg), (Energy), Asian Institute of Technology
  • Bachelor of Science (BSc), (Power), Ahsanullah University of Science and Technology

Honors and Achievements

  • DAAD scholarship, Indian Institute of Technology Bombay (IIT Bombay), 2017
  • Asian Development Bank-Japanese Scholarship Program (ADB-JSP) scholarship, Asian Institute of Technology, 2017
  • Dean’s List of Honor for undergraduate studies at AUST, Ahsanullah University of Science and Technology, 2014
  • AUST merit Scholarship, Ahsanullah University of Science and Technology, 2010
